Abstract

An optimized breakwater structure of a liquefied gas tank car comprises a liquefied gas tank body (1), a pair of connecting ribs (2) and a breakwater body (3), wherein two ends of the pair of connecting ribs (2) are respectively installed on the liquefied gas tank body (1), and the pair of connecting ribs (2) are respectively fixed in the middle of the left end and the middle of the right end of the breakwater body (3). The advantages are that: because the pair of connecting ribs are respectively fixed in the middle of the left end and the middle of the right end of the wave-proof plate, the stress of the wave-proof plate is reduced, and the service life of the wave-proof plate is prolonged.

Background technique
At present, move, the Saxboard of wave resistance effect has been installed in liquefied gas tank body in order to prevent liquid gas wave in liquefied gas tank body; Saxboard is installed in the tank body through connecting tendon; Its deficiency is: the connecting tendon in the existing liquid gas tank body is the left and right two ends that are fixed on Saxboard, and the Saxboard middle part is long, and maximum stress is bigger; The Yi Sheng fracture causes shorten the working life of Saxboard.
The model utility content
The purpose of the utility model is exactly to be the left and right two ends that are fixed on Saxboard to the connecting tendon in the existing liquid gas tank body; The Saxboard middle part is long; Maximum stress is bigger; Yi Sheng fracture, cause Saxboard shortenings in working life deficiency and a kind of Railway Tank Cars for Liquefied Gas Saxboard structure that reduces Saxboard stress is provided.
The utility model is made up of liquid gas tank body, a pair of connecting tendon and Saxboard, and a pair of connecting tendon two ends are installed in respectively on the liquid gas tank body, and a pair of connecting tendon is separately fixed at the left end middle part and the right-hand member middle part of Saxboard.The utility model has the advantages that: since with a pair of connecting tendon respectively with the left end middle part that is fixed on Saxboard and right-hand member in the middle part of; Compare with former connecting tendon mounting type; Strengthen the length at Saxboard two ends, thereby shortened the length at Saxboard middle part, reduced the inner maximum stress level of Saxboard effectively; Thereby improved the surge ability of impact force of Saxboard opposing, prolonged working life of Saxboard.
